Missing 'left turn' sign
Reported in the Road Markings category anonymously at 10:08, Thu 6 December 2018
Sent to Oxfordshire County Council 2 minutes later
Several accidents have occurred at this junction over the last few years, as it's blind to the South West when turning FROM the Little Compton Road. The warning 'left turn' sign that was there about four years ago seems to have disappeared. However, any replacement, possibly needs to say that a vehicle could be in the road when they come along, as motorists do tear a long it, as it's a bit of a rat run. A mirror reflecting traffic from the South West would also be useful facing the Little Compton Road as this really is a 'do or die' junction. The problem is intensified when the hedge/grass verge needs cutting.
